dc.description.abstractThis project aims to solve the problem of vertical transport of charges raised by a company with the standard UNE 58-132-91/6. The purpose of this project is the industrial design of a system of load handling by a bi-columned lifting device, tractioned by flat belts and steel cables from a transport level to a different level in order to connect two different assembly lines situated at different heights. The goal of this project is lifting a 780 Kg load at a 2.400 mm height. The project design ranges from the loading and unloading process, vertical transport, as well as the security mechanisms needed to ensure the correct operation. This project also includes the relevant economic study to determine the cost of the machine.
